About This Color

PANTONE 82-3-5 U is a desaturated blue with medium tonality. Its HEX value is #687680, placing it in the blue region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 205°.

This mid-range tone offers excellent versatility, working in both digital interfaces and print applications. It provides strong visual impact while maintaining readability when paired with light or dark text.
